To open a clogged burner on a Blackstone Griddle, follow these steps: Turn off the griddle and let it cool completely. Remove the grates from the griddle. Use a soft brush or cloth to clean any grease or food particles from the burners and surrounding areas. Check for any visible obstructions in the burners, such as spider webs or debris.

To reset your regulator, just follow the steps as we outlined above. Turn off the fuel, disconnect the hose from the regulator, turn your burners to high, wait for one minute, turn off the burners, and then reconnect it all again. This should hopefully fix the issue. If your Blackstone griddle igniter isn't working, then check the following to fix it: Check the igniter batteries aren't dead. Check and tighten loose wiring. Clear the igniter electrode of dust and debris. Replace the failed igniter. Wait until the oil begins to smoke, and the surface begins to darken.Step 1 – If your Blackstone has a lid, open it completely to keep gas from building up and igniting when you light it. Step 2 – Slowly turn the valve on the propane tank counterclockwise to open. Step 3 – Turn the first burner on high. Step 4 – Push the ignitor button to light the initial burner.

The igniter is compatible with the Blackstone 36-inch griddle and does not come with the purchase package. How do I reset my regulator? First, turn off all the burners, turn off the propane valve and disconnect the hose. Remove the regulator, wait a few minutes and then re-attach it. You can leave the tank attached to the grill but you should turn off the valve on the tank to prevent any gas from leaking out while not in use.Investing in New York City's No. 1 residential landlord is complicated by the work-from-home economy and Fed policy....BX All roads lead to New York City ... and all signs poin...Mix a solution of soapy water and apply it to all the connections. Turn on the gas tank, but not the griddle, and check for bubbles. If you see bubbles forming at any connection point, there might be a gas leak. In that case, turn off the gas tank immediately, tighten the connections, and retest.
